21 West Town Road, Backwell, Bristol, BS48 3HA

Detached Freehold

Found 1 transactions going back to June 2001.

Date Price Percentage
18 Jun 2001 £ 262,500

This Detached property is located at 21 West Town Road, Backwell, Bristol, BS48 3HA and was last sold for £262,500 on 18 Jun 2001.